AGBU New York Summer Internship Program alumni to gather July 21July 12, 2012 - 12:02 AMT PanARMENIAN.Net - On July 21 alumni, friends, and supporters of the Armenian General Benevolent Union (AGBU) New York Summer Internship Program (NYSIP) will gather in New York City's Battery Gardens to celebrate its silver jubilee and honor the individuals who made it a successful and flagship Program, The Armenian Weekly reports. First and foremost on the list of honorees are the Program's Founders and Emeritus Life Chairpersons - Rita and Vartkess† Balian. As their brainchild, the New York Summer Internship Program has provided career and life enhancing opportunities for 25 years to Armenian university students from 21 countries throughout the world. There are over 800 accomplished alumni to date, many of whom have stayed engaged in AGBU by forming Young Professionals groups and other initiatives, as well as giving back to their respective communities.
